PyQt5 – Crea un reloj digital

En este artículo veremos cómo crear un reloj digital usando PyQt5, este reloj digital básicamente indicará la hora actual en formato de 24 horas. Para poder crear un reloj digital tenemos que hacer lo siguiente: 1. Cree un diseño vertical. 2. Cree una etiqueta para mostrar la hora actual, colóquela en el diseño y alinéela … Continue reading «PyQt5 – Crea un reloj digital»

Python | Función de enlace en Tkinter

Tkinter es un módulo GUI (interfaz gráfica de usuario) que se usa ampliamente en aplicaciones de escritorio. Viene junto con Python, pero también puede instalarlo externamente con la ayuda del comando  pip . Proporciona una variedad de clases y funciones de Widget con la ayuda de las cuales uno puede hacer que nuestra GUI sea … Continue reading «Python | Función de enlace en Tkinter»

PyQt5: color de fondo para la flecha hacia abajo de ComboBox cuando se presiona

En este artículo, veremos cómo podemos establecer el color de fondo en la flecha hacia abajo del cuadro combinado cuando se presiona. La flecha hacia abajo es la parte del botón del cuadro combinado que, cuando se presiona, abre la vista de lista de elementos. Para agregar color a la flecha hacia abajo cuando se … Continue reading «PyQt5: color de fondo para la flecha hacia abajo de ComboBox cuando se presiona»

PyQt5 – Barra de imagen como barra de progreso

En este artículo veremos cómo agregar una imagen a la barra de la barra de progreso. Podemos configurar la imagen de fondo, pero para configurar la imagen en una barra, tenemos que modificar el fragmento CSS de la barra de progreso, a continuación se muestra cómo se ve la imagen de fondo normal y la … Continue reading «PyQt5 – Barra de imagen como barra de progreso»

PyQt5 QCommandLinkButton: configuración de borde para estados de desplazamiento

En este artículo, veremos cómo podemos configurar el borde del QCommandLinkButton de acuerdo con los estados de desplazamiento. El botón de enlace de comando es un tipo especial de botón que tiene cualidades tanto de botón pulsador como de botón de radio. De forma predeterminada, no hay un borde adicional en el botón de enlace … Continue reading «PyQt5 QCommandLinkButton: configuración de borde para estados de desplazamiento»

PyQt5 ComboBox: tamaño de borde diferente cuando no se puede editar y se presiona

En este artículo veremos cómo podemos establecer un ancho de borde diferente para el cuadro combinado cuando no es editable y se presiona, cuando establecemos el borde del cuadro combinado es del mismo color para todos los lados, aunque podemos cambiar el color de cada lado respectivamente. Solo aparecerá un ancho de borde diferente. El … Continue reading «PyQt5 ComboBox: tamaño de borde diferente cuando no se puede editar y se presiona»

Agregar tema de color personalizado en PySimpleGUI

PySimpleGUI permite a los usuarios elegir temas para su lista de temas. Además, permite a los usuarios especificar y personalizar el tema según su elección. El usuario solo debe conocer los tonos de color, es decir, los códigos hexadecimales de los colores. En consecuencia, puede personalizar el tema con nuevos colores. Ejemplo: import PySimpleGUI as … Continue reading «Agregar tema de color personalizado en PySimpleGUI»

Python | TextInput en kivy usando el archivo .kv

Kivy es una herramienta GUI independiente de la plataforma en Python. Como se puede ejecutar en Android, IOS, Linux y Windows, etc. Básicamente se usa para desarrollar la aplicación de Android, pero eso no significa que no se pueda usar en aplicaciones de escritorio. 👉🏽 Tutorial de Kivy: aprenda Kivy con ejemplos . Entrada de … Continue reading «Python | TextInput en kivy usando el archivo .kv»

Python | Haz una ventana simple usando kivy

Kivy es una plataforma independiente, ya que se puede ejecutar en Android, IOS, Linux y Windows, etc. Kivy le brinda la funcionalidad de escribir el código una vez y ejecutarlo en diferentes plataformas. Básicamente se usa para desarrollar la aplicación de Android, pero no significa que no se pueda usar en aplicaciones de escritorio. Use … Continue reading «Python | Haz una ventana simple usando kivy»

PyQt5 – método isLeftToRight() para la casilla de verificación

Cuando creamos una casilla de verificación por defecto, el indicador está en el lado izquierdo, al que llamamos dirección de izquierda a derecha, aunque podemos cambiar su dirección usando el setLayoutDirectionmétodo. isLeftToRightEl método se utiliza para verificar si la dirección del diseño es de izquierda a derecha o no, devuelve True para la dirección del … Continue reading «PyQt5 – método isLeftToRight() para la casilla de verificación»